KTM 1290 Super Duke R 180 horsepower to 189 kg!
With a new V-twin 75 ° 1 301 cm3 developing 180 hp. at 8870 rev / min and a maximum torque of 144 Nm maximum torque – and more than 100 Nm at 2500 r / min – for only 189 kg (without fuel) KTM1290 Super Duke R can accelerate from 0 to 200 km / h in 7.2 seconds in the free world!
KTM 1290 Super Duke R Brakes superbike
To contain the enthusiasm of the gear, KTM first concocted a worthy of a superbike chassis: a new trellis frame in tubular steel chrome forks and 48 mm WP, single-sided swing arm swinging a little, and – most importantly – two-piece radial calipers Brembo M50 biting of the 320 mm front discs.
KTM 1290 Super Duke R A Sporty Electronic
All this beautiful material complements of course a full electronic staffing: ABS forest 9ME (with mode Super mortared: ABS on the front wheel and total freedom at the rear for drifter!) disconnectable, ride-by-wire Keihin Accelerator, traction control, engine mapping (Rain and Sport)…

KTM 1290 Super Duke R: the essential
- V-Twin Features at 75degrees, 1,301 cm3 (bore 108 mm x stroke 71 mm)
- Free Version: 180 hp at 8,870 rpm, max torque 144 Nm
- Trellis frame tubes of chrome molybdenum steel
- Suspensions WP
- Front calipers Brembo M50
- Empty weight: 189 kg
- Seat height: 835 mm
- 18-liter tank
